完善资料让更多小伙伴认识你,还能领取20积分哦, 立即完善>
` 本帖最后由 zhangyue510 于 2021-8-2 15:37 编辑 项目介绍: 本模块可与perf-v简易示波器配合使用。 通过在ROM查找表中存储波形数据,总共存储了四组波形,分别为正弦波,方波,三角波,三角波,每组波形共采样4096个点。通过调整步进值以控制输出频率,输出为10bit位宽数据,经由DA FPGA驱动由并行数据转换为串行数据后,传输给DA模块,由DA模块转化为模拟量输出。本项目使用DA模块为TLC5615. 波形发生器输出初始频率可自主调整,波形会在增大到初始频率50倍后开始出现轻微的锯齿。 按下核心板上K1按键可将波形发生器重置为初始状态; 拨动拨码开关SW1可调整步进值,每次拨动增加1; 拨动拨码开关SW2可调整波形,每次拨动改变波形,往复循环,分别为: 正弦波、方波、三角波、三角波; 拨动拨码开关SW3可调整步进值,每次拨动减小1; AD模块: 使用TLC5615 串行DA模块。 实验步骤: 一.安装Xilinx公司的Vivado软件 (此处不赘述) 二.打开例程 三.点击生成比特流(.bit)文件
四.烧入程序至核心板 首先将核心板上电,将下载器连接至电脑并按下蓝色开关 依次点击 随后在出现的HARDWAREMANAGER中点击Program device 在弹出的窗口中选择Bitstreamfile,一般情况下会自动填充,亦可在本工程目录下project_DDS.runsimpl_1目录中寻找.bit文件(即第三步生成的文件) 五.接上DA模块后,外接示波器查看波形 将DA模块的数据输入口(DI)、串行时钟口(SCK)与片选口(CS)分别使用杜邦线连接至下图1、2、3口(亦可直接插入) 将示波器信号输入端接在AD模块输出口上即可查看波形 六.调整波形与步进值 按下核心板上Key1按键可将波形发生器重置为初始状态; 拨动拨码开关SW1可调整步进值,每次拨动增加1; 拨动拨码开关SW2可调整波形,每次拨动改变波形,往复循环,分别为: 正弦波、方波、三角波、三角波(非重复,预留空间); 拨动拨码开关SW1可调整步进值,每次拨动减小1; |
|
相关推荐
|
|
只有小组成员才能发言,加入小组>>
RVBoards-哪吒(RISC-V SBC):系统镜像制作及烧录指导
3896 浏览 0 评论
5274 浏览 0 评论
4343 浏览 0 评论
欢迎RVBoards入驻电子发烧友社区,共创开发者最喜爱的小组!
6328 浏览 1 评论
【Perf-V资料目录】看这里~~~最全的Perf-V(RISC-V FPGA开发板)资料目录贴
10868 浏览 0 评论
小黑屋| 手机版| Archiver| 电子发烧友 ( 湘ICP备2023018690号 )
GMT+8, 2024-12-25 12:53 , Processed in 0.523229 second(s), Total 69, Slave 50 queries .
Powered by 电子发烧友网
© 2015 bbs.elecfans.com
关注我们的微信
下载发烧友APP
电子发烧友观察
版权所有 © 湖南华秋数字科技有限公司
电子发烧友 (电路图) 湘公网安备 43011202000918 号 电信与信息服务业务经营许可证:合字B2-20210191 工商网监 湘ICP备2023018690号